. He has written two books, and created one video tape. The first book, published in 1982, was titled "Shake Your Head, Darling". The video tape on hairstyling tips, called "Why Do I Call You Sexy?", was created in 1983. His second book, titled "Beyond Hair: The Ultimate Makeover Book" was published in 1990. On June 9, 2008, José was honored with the Global Salon Business Awards Lifetime Achievement award.

Biography

Born in Nice, France to André and Chana Eber, he is the youngest of three with a brother, Henri, and sister, Esther. José began styling hair at age twelve. His mother and sister were the patient first clients for this aspiring stylist. He began his official career as a hairstylist apprentice at a chic Paris salon at only fifteen years of age. At twenty-six, on his first visit to the States, José fell in love with Los Angeles

In a desire to free American women from their stiff, sprayed styles of the day, José created a sexy, carefree unstructured look that was easier to maintain and which instantly became "de rigueur" for an entire generation. His first celebrity client was Farrah Fawcett

Upon establishment of his reputation among Hollywood's celebs, José opened his first signature salon in Beverly Hills and ten years later expanded into his salon on 2 Rodeo Drive. There are now two José Eber Atelier salons in the country.

Now a world recognized celebrity, José Eber is a much sought after television personality appearing regularly on both international, national and local talk shows. Appearances include programs such as "Oprah", "Entertainment Tonight", ABC's "Good Morning America", "CNN" and NBC's "The Today Show", as a guest judge on Bravo's "Shear Genius", and most recently on "Nightline"

In the rare moments when he is not working, José Eber is active in numerous charities. He was one of the first to join the fight against domestic violence on behalf of the Sojourn Organization. “ Women who are abused usually have little or no self-esteem,” says José,” Because my career has been about helping women raise their self-esteem, this fight became very important to me.” José also supports The Foundation for an Independent Tomorrow (FIT), a non-profit organization that helps unemployed or underemployed women.
